REMEMBERING THE BRAVE CEREMONIES
The Armed Forces are steeped in tradition and ceremony. It is only fitting that similar gravity is considered when honoring the families of the brave. Remembering the accomplishments and lives of the brave is very important.
Each year we provide the ceremony and elements that honor our heroes' families with the dignified presentation of full mounted sets of medals, as well as any posthumous awards and decorations. This formal, black-tie ceremony creates an atmosphere of honor and one of solemn remembrance for each attending family’s fallen hero, as they are personally recognized during the evening. Attendance at the ceremony is open to all interested parties, however, families of fallen heroes our guests of the foundation.
Throughout the year, Remembering the Brave hosts a number of other events within the scope of our mission to raise funds for this ceremony. As each family member is a guest, their attendance and all the costs of their special evening are solely provided through donations and fundraising efforts. It is our hope to sponsor more than 50 families at our 9thannual ceremony, September 10th, 2011. With your help, we can provide one or more families with memories that will last a lifetime, and at the end of the night, we have left them with the knowledge their community has reached out to say “thank you”, and they know without a doubt, we will forever remember their loved one’s service and sacrifice for this nation.

The Colorado PRSA Young Professionals Committee offers an outlet for professional development, best-practice sharing and networking in a social setting for young professionals in the Denver area. The Young Professionals Committee hosts several events throughout the year from professional development programs, including our newly launched book club to networking socials and mentorship programs. Our definition of "young" is very broad, so as long as you are new to the profession and young at heart, you will fit right in.
